What Magic: The Gathering Cards Are Most Popular?

Tulsa players seek out Commander staples like "Lightning Greaves," "Cultivate," and iconic legendary creatures essential to popular decks. Modern mainstays such as "Inquisition of Kozilek" and "Liliana of the Veil" fuel tournament play. Pioneer staples include "Scavenging Ooze" and "Thoughtseize." Collectors prize premium foils, alternate art cards, and sealed collector boosters. Legendary commander cards and rare vintage pieces attract a range of Magic enthusiasts in Tulsa.

How Magic Card Values Are Determined

In Tulsa, Magic card values hinge on rarity—mythic rares generally command higher prices—and condition, particularly for graded cards. Demand in popular formats like Commander or Modern affects prices, as does collector interest in limited print runs, alternate versions, and foil treatments. Sealed products such as booster boxes and collector boosters tend to hold or gain value with time.

Tips Before Buying Magic Cards in Tulsa

  • Assess the card’s condition carefully, noting wear and potential damage.
  • Understand format legality differences if targeting competitive play.
  • Compare recent sales to gauge market value accurately.
  • Use protective accessories to extend card lifespan.
  • Research popular Commander cards to maximize deck potential.
  • Confirm the tournament status of cards prior to entry.
  • Separate collecting goals from purely gameplay-driven purchases.
